British Pound tumbles as Warsh revives Fed hike bets

The Pound Sterling (GBP) tumbles versus the US Dollar (USD) on Friday as Federal Reserve (Fed) Chair Kevin Warsh put inflation as the priority at the Fed, increasing the likelihood of an interest rate hike next month. The GBP/USD trades at 1.3538, down 0.40%.
